Q: Can I reuse the old wax ring when replacing toilet bolts?

A: No. The wax ring degrades over time and can develop cracks or lose its sealant properties. Always use a new wax ring (or a modern alternative like a foam or rubber seal) when reinstalling the toilet to ensure a watertight fit.

Q: What’s the best way to remove corroded bolts that won’t budge?

A: Apply penetrating oil (like WD-40) to the bolts and let it sit for 15–30 minutes. If that fails, use a rubber mallet to tap the wrench gently, or drill a small hole in the bolt head to insert a screw extractor. Avoid excessive force to prevent cracking the porcelain.

Q: Do I need to remove the toilet entirely to replace the bolts?

A: Yes. Toilet bolts require the toilet to be lifted off the flange to access the threads properly. If you’re unsure about lifting the toilet, enlist a helper or use a toilet lifter tool to avoid injury.

Q: How often should I check my toilet bolts for tightness?

A: At least once a year, especially if you notice any movement, leaks, or unusual noises. Additionally, check them after any major plumbing work or if the toilet has been subjected to vibrations (e.g., from construction or heavy foot traffic).

Q: What’s the most common mistake people make when replacing toilet bolts?

A: Over-tightening the bolts, which can crack the porcelain base or strip the flange threads. Always tighten them evenly and just until the toilet is secure—no need for excessive force.

Q: Can I use duct tape or other makeshift solutions to secure loose bolts?

A: No. Temporary fixes like duct tape or plumber’s putty are not reliable long-term solutions. They can degrade, attract pests, or fail under pressure, leading to leaks. Always replace bolts with proper hardware.

Q: Is it necessary to shut off the water before replacing toilet bolts?

A: Yes. Always turn off the water supply valve (located behind the toilet) and flush the tank to empty the bowl before lifting the toilet. This prevents spills and makes the process cleaner and safer.
